Enayi B Tamakloe (born march 29, 1996) known professionally as Marvelous, is an American record producer. Marvelous was born and raised in Scotch Plains, New Jersey.He is an up and coming record producer with songs coming soon from some of the biggest artists in the world.

Producing and Songwriting[edit]

What started with garageband and jazz band in middle school quickly grew into something more. While attending Scotch Plains Fanwood Highschool he was selected to be a drummer for the Moonglowers, the top jazz band in New Jersey. Marvelous then made his first self- produced song to represent his senior year, and eventually dropped his first EP titled “Yearbook ‘14”. Yearbook gained traction locally and he continued to grow as a musician at the Hartt School of Music where he was a Jazz studies Major with a concentration in percussion During Marvelous’ time at the Hartt School of Music he worked tirelessly to learn music in its many forms, teaching himself piano and guitar. His love for musical instruments did not stop his fascination for production. Marvelous worked day in and day out each year of his college career to find his sound. Freshman year was dedicate solely to melodies and chord progression. Sophomore Year Marvelous honed in on the synchronization, analysis, and deconstruction of drums.[1]
